February is American Heart Month

Many organizations in the U.S. dedicate the month of February to heart health. It's a month to spread awareness about the importance of it, with heart disease being a leading cause of death for Americans, reports U.S. Department of Health and Human Service (DHHS). Some heart-healthy initiatives include:
  • Million Hearts Initiative aims to prevent 1 million heart attacks and strokes throughout the next 5 years. 
  • The Heart Truth campaign is dedicated to addressing women's heart health and will celebrate its 10th anniversary this year.
  • The Let's Move! initiative targets childhood obesity by encouraging healthy foods and activities for kids.  
  • American Heart Association also has numerous programs and tips to prevent a healthy heart.
